Annual Total Assets for Dime Community Bancshares, Inc. (1995–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Dime Community Bancshares, Inc. from 1995 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$15.34 Billion | +6.89% |
| 2024-12-31 | $14.35 Billion | +5.26% |
| 2023-12-31 | $13.64 Billion | +3.38% |
| 2022-12-31 | $13.19 Billion | +9.31% |
| 2021-12-31 | $12.07 Billion | +77.93% |
| 2020-12-31 | $6.78 Billion | +6.72% |
| 2019-12-31 | $6.35 Billion | +0.54% |
| 2018-12-31 | $6.32 Billion | -1.29% |
| 2017-12-31 | $6.40 Billion | +6.63% |
| 2016-12-31 | $6.01 Billion | +19.32% |
| 2015-12-31 | $5.03 Billion | +11.91% |
| 2014-12-31 | $4.50 Billion | +11.64% |
| 2013-12-31 | $4.03 Billion | +3.14% |
| 2012-12-31 | $3.91 Billion | -2.88% |
| 2011-12-31 | $4.02 Billion | -0.47% |
| 2010-12-31 | $4.04 Billion | +2.23% |
| 2009-12-31 | $3.95 Billion | -2.55% |
| 2008-12-31 | $4.06 Billion | +15.84% |
| 2007-12-31 | $3.50 Billion | +10.33% |
| 2006-12-31 | $3.17 Billion | +1.51% |
| 2005-12-31 | $3.13 Billion | -7.43% |
| 2004-12-31 | $3.38 Billion | +13.65% |
| 2003-12-31 | $2.97 Billion | +0.86% |
| 2002-12-31 | $2.95 Billion | +4.85% |
| 2001-12-31 | $2.81 Billion | +3.25% |
| 2000-12-31 | $2.72 Billion | +8.78% |
| 1999-12-31 | $2.50 Billion | +11.32% |
| 1998-12-31 | $2.25 Billion | +38.41% |
| 1997-12-31 | $1.62 Billion | +23.49% |
| 1996-12-31 | $1.31 Billion | -4.14% |
| 1995-12-31 | $1.37 Billion | -- |
About Dime Community Bancshares, Inc.
Dime Community Bancshares, Inc. operates as the holding company for Dime Community Bank that engages in the provision of various commercial banking and financial services. It accepts time, savings, and demand deposits from the businesses, consumers, and local municipalities.
